PHOENIX — C.J. McCollum scored 31 points, Zion Williamson had 29 and the New Orleans Pelicans beat the Phoenix Suns 113-105 on Sunday, leaving the teams tied for the sixth and final guaranteed Western Conference playoff spot. Both teams are 46-32 with four games remaining, two games behind fifth-place Dallas. The Suns own the tiebreaker, having won the season series 2-1. Williamson returned after sitting out Friday night in a loss at San Antonio because of a finger injury. Devin Booker scored 25 points for Phoenix, but was 0 for 6 from 3-point range. In his previous three games against the Pelicans, he scored 50 or more points, including a 52-point game Monday night in New Orleans. Bradley Beal led Phoenix with 33 points.
